4 Days in Hyderabad: Unveiling the City of Nizams

Nancy D

Nancy D

23 Nov 2023

Embark on a captivating journey through the historic city of Hyderabad, where ancient marvels meet modern delights. Discover the rich heritage of Golconda Fort, immerse yourself in the vibrant culture of Shilparamam, and experience the serenity of Qutub Shahi Tombs. Indulge in thrilling water adventures at Jalavihar Water Park, marvel at the majestic Buddha Statue, and unwind amidst the lush greenery of Indira Park. Immerse yourself in art at Kalakriti Art Gallery, seek blessings at Birla Mandir, and delve into history at Telangana State Archaeology Museum and The Nizam's Museum. Finally, be enchanted by the grandeur of Chowmahalla Palace, embrace the iconic Charminar, and lose yourself in the mesmerizing exhibits of Salar Jung Museum.
